Responsibilities
Location: Pennsylvania or New Jersey Offices
Experience: 3-5 Years
Practice Area: Labor & Employment / General Litigation Defense
An established law firm is seeking an experienced Employment Law Associate to join its Labor and Employment practice. The attorney will handle a wide range of labor and employment matters, along with some general litigation defense matters in Pennsylvania and New Jersey.
Responsibilities
- Handle labor and employment matters from inception through resolution.
- Defend employment-related claims and litigation.
- Handle liability claims, insurance defense, and/or complex litigation matters.
- Draft pleadings, motions, and other legal documents.
- Respond to and manage written discovery.
- Take and defend depositions.
- Participate in arbitrations and trials.
- Conduct legal research and prepare written analyses and briefs.
- Manage multiple matters while maintaining strong organization and attention to detail.
